Basically. Few patches ago they gave us the ability to replace skills with the click of a macro by using /hotbar action "action name" (hotbar) (skillslot). So say you had "/hotbar action "Physick" 1 5" when executed it'll put physick in the 5th slot on hotbar #1. It didn't have much use before but now that you can use pet skills, items and whatnot you could make a Summon macro that replaces 4 slots with the appropriate fairy skills rather than needing 8 slot or separate bars. Unfortunately it doesn't work with macro's themselves, so if you use Whispering Dawn macros you're sorta outta luck but still useful.
